### 1. Mapbox

Free tier4.6· Free

Mapbox is what you choose when the map has to look like your product rather than like Google's. Styles are fully designable down to individual layers, GL JS renders vector tiles client-side, and the navigation SDK is good enough that car makers ship it. Pricing is pay-as-you-go with a real free tier — 50,000 map loads a month — then $5 per 1,000 loads. Support plans are optional add-ons, not required.

### 2. MapTiler

Free tier4.5· Free · paid from $30/mo

MapTiler serves vector and raster tiles built from OpenStreetMap, with a drop-in JS SDK that is close enough to Mapbox GL to make migration easy. Flex is $30/month for 25,000 map sessions and 500,000 API requests — a fraction of Google or Mapbox at the same volume. The escape hatch matters too: MapTiler Server can run the whole tile stack on your own hardware.

### 3. Geoapify

Free tier4.4· Free · paid from $59/mo

Geoapify is a focused API company rather than a map-rendering platform: geocoding and reverse geocoding, routing and route matrices, isochrones, and a places database, all from OpenStreetMap and open data. Pricing is by daily credits — API 10 at $59/month gives 10,000 a day — and the free tier allows limited commercial use, which is unusual and useful for small projects.

### 4. LocationIQ

Free tier4.3· Free · paid from $45/mo

LocationIQ's pitch is price: geocoding at a small fraction of Google's rate, with clear daily quotas and soft limits that let you burst to 200% rather than failing requests. Maps Lite is $45/month for 10,000 daily map views; the $100 Developer tier adds geocoding and routing to the same account. It is deliberately unglamorous infrastructure — no map designer, no places-rich dataset, just cheap, reliable lookups.
